Elm highlights digital transformation at LEAP 2026 in Riyadh

Elm will be showcasing its digital solutions for both government and business sectors at the fifth LEAP 2026 conference, taking place from August 31 to September 3 at the Riyadh Exhibition and Convention Center in Mulhaim. Elm is participating as a business solutions partner during a conference that aligns with the 2026 Year of Artificial Intelligence.

The company will highlight its expertise in facilitating digital transformation across various sectors, emphasizing its commitment to leveraging artificial intelligence to drive tangible change in people's lives and enhance daily services and operations. This year's theme, "Intelligence Paving the Way," underscores Elm's strategy to harness AI for decision-making, operational efficiency, user experience improvement, and overall impact enhancement.

With a digital ecosystem serving over 30 million users across more than 16 sectors, Elm conducts more than 3 billion digital transactions annually through 350 electronic services. The company operates through four offices beyond Saudi Arabia, reflecting its regional and international scope.

At the conference, Elm will present its technology solutions and real-world experiences, offering a specialized program for entrepreneurs and small to medium enterprises. This initiative aims to bolster the innovation ecosystem, foster new growth opportunities, expand partnership networks, and open avenues for business expansion in both regional and international markets.
